DIREKT Admin Portal Architecture

Purpose

The DIREKT operations portal is the internal desktop-oriented interface for verification, field work, support, trust and safety, finance exceptions, audit and controlled configuration.

It is not a public marketplace client and is never hosted through GitHub Pages.

Hard boundary

The portal consumes the versioned DIREKT backend API. It must never:

  • import a PostgreSQL client;
  • connect directly to the database;
  • connect directly to object storage;
  • construct private evidence URLs;
  • trust client-provided roles;
  • embed production secrets in browser bundles;
  • place sensitive content in public/static output or browser logs.

The backend performs authentication, role resolution, provider scope, object authorization and audit.

Navigation is derived from the backend-compatible permission fixture rather than the displayed role name. Tests prove that:

  • reviewers see verification navigation but not finance or administration;
  • finance sees finance navigation but not verification controls;
  • an admin label without server permissions produces no navigation;
  • hidden navigation never implies backend permission.

Security response headers

All routes set or require:

  • X-Robots-Tag: noindex, nofollow, noarchive;
  • X-Content-Type-Options: nosniff;
  • X-Frame-Options: DENY;
  • Referrer-Policy: no-referrer;
  • restrictive Permissions Policy;
  • Content Security Policy;
  • removal of the framework-powered header.

The Phase 2C CSP is a foundation and must be reviewed again when real API connections, analytics or evidence rendering are introduced.

Accessibility baseline

The shell includes:

  • skip navigation;
  • semantic header, navigation, aside and main landmarks;
  • visible keyboard focus;
  • 44-pixel minimum interactive targets;
  • scalable typography;
  • responsive single-column behaviour;
  • synthetic-status announcement;
  • disabled-state semantics;
  • reduced-motion handling.

Server-rendered tests assert the required landmarks and warning state. Later phases add browser E2E, automated accessibility tooling and representative user testing.

Privileged session requirements

Real operations access must use:

  • short-lived access/session state;
  • inactivity and absolute session limits;
  • mandatory MFA before pilot;
  • server-side permission resolution;
  • step-up authentication for sensitive actions;
  • revocation and device/session management;
  • reasoned, append-only audit for privileged actions.

Phase 2C represents these rules but uses only a synthetic reviewer fixture in the UI.

Testing and CI

The portal workflow proves on a clean runner:

npm ci --ignore-scripts
npm run format:check
npm run lint
npm run typecheck
npm run test
npm run build

It also rejects direct database/storage imports, committed environment files and missing no-index configuration. Coverage and build manifests are retained as artifacts.
